3 All rights reserved © 2005, Alcatel Grid services over IMS / GridNets ’06 / 2006-10-02 Page 3 Objectives  What we want : Network operators to provide computing & storage utility services  Control & Co-allocate resources (Network, CPUs, Storage…)  Added Value : Resource virtualization (location & heterogeneity) Application able to request service with QoS constraints Network automatically provision resources  And compliant with Open Grid Service Architecture

4 All rights reserved © 2005, Alcatel Grid services over IMS / GridNets ’06 / 2006-10-02 Page 4 Requirements From the OGSA framework  Information services (Resource Discovery)  Job Execution (Resource Selection)  Resource Management (Supervision)  Security (Authorization Authentication Accounting)  Self-Management (Optimization) 2 approaches  State of the Art : –Network provides connectivity services with QoS constraint  Our proposal : –Network provides Grid services

5 All rights reserved © 2005, Alcatel Grid services over IMS / GridNets ’06 / 2006-10-02 Page 5 Overview of QoS techniques Over-provisioning (Current internet) Static-provisioning (PSTN) End-to-end probes and Application self admission control Bandwidth Broker Signaled provisioning Feedback based provisioning Diffserv (no guarantee, but differentiation) Combination of these techniques

6 All rights reserved © 2005, Alcatel Grid services over IMS / GridNets ’06 / 2006-10-02 Page 6 Focus on Signaled provisioning approaches Mono-Signaling – Network Level Mono-Signaling – Application level,  With a central Bandwidth Broker  Interconnected to a distributed network control plane Dual Signaling

15 All rights reserved © 2005, Alcatel Grid services over IMS / GridNets ’06 / 2006-10-02 Conclusion : Why IMS ?  Common Objectives & Functionalities  IMS is already under trial and deployment by telcos IMS objectives: Multimedia services Person to person communication Grid services : Resource access services Machine to Machine communication Common Objectives: Sell new services QoS required One network for all services Common Functions: User Authentication per session/service charging Destination selection Features negotiation Supervision environment
